Abstract

A non-volatile memory device (and method of manufacture) is disclosed and structured to enable a write operation using an ionization impact process in a first portion of the device and a read operation using a tunneling process in a second portion of the device. The non-volatile memory device (1) increases hot carrier injection efficiency, (2) decreases power consumption, and (3) enables voltage and device scaling in the non-volatile memory devices.
